Cars and driving — what they are made of
7 cars and driving objects, broken down.
| Object | Made of |
|---|---|
| Car tire | Several different rubber compounds reinforced with steel and textile cord — closer to a composite than to rubber. |
| Car battery | Lead and lead dioxide plates in dilute sulfuric acid, in a polypropylene case — mostly lead, by weight. |
| Airbag | A coated nylon bag inflated by a small solid-propellant gas generator in about thirty milliseconds. |
| Brake pad | A friction compound of fibres, fillers and resin, moulded and bonded onto a steel backing plate. |
| Windshield (windscreen) | Two sheets of ordinary glass laminated to a tough plastic interlayer, which is what stops it falling out. |
| Spark plug | A ceramic insulator carrying a centre electrode of nickel, platinum or iridium inside a steel shell. |
| Seatbelt | Woven polyester webbing designed to stretch a controlled amount, plus a locking retractor and a pyrotechnic pretensioner. |
